Can anyone tell me much about the differences between the 2 bedroom and 3 bedroom Presidential casitas at Granby/Rocky Mountain Preserve?
There is only one 2 BR Casita. It has good views of the valley, however the traffic to and from the resort passes by just below the outside deck. I have not been in it, but it does look noticeably smaller than the 3 BR Casitas.

There are twelve or thirteen 3 BR Casitas. The view from five or six of them is of the 3 BR Casitas across the narrow road between them. If you book a 3 BR Casita, definitely call a few days ahead and request one with a view, although it will depend on which units are turning over that day.

Most of the Casitas have parking for only two vehicles. It is a short hike from the main parking lot for any additional cars.

I prefer a view, so for the same amount of points, I book the regular (not SN) 3 BR Presidential that is in the main building with a guaranteed view of the surrounding valley. Hot tub on the deck just like the Casitas. The master bedroom is upstairs.
